DataFrame中的数据类型转换

想知道DataFrame中的object类型怎么转成float,很奇怪网上搜了半天没找到…
查看DataFrame中各列的数据类型:
print data.dtypes
在读入文件时设置数据类型:
data = pd.read_csv("../test.csv",dtype={'name':np.str,'age': np.int32})
将指定列转成float类型:
data[['money']] = data[['money']].astype(float)

1 条评论

[/0o0] [..^v^..] [0_0] [T.T] [=3-❤] [❤.❤] [^v^] [-.0] [!- -] [=x=] [→_→] [><] 更多 »
昵称
  1. 巧儿 QQbrowser 9 QQbrowser 9 Windows 7 Windows 7

    谢谢博主分享,欢迎回访,无人自助终端项目http://www.makingh.com